Open- 38 starters
1st-06/07 NFTCH Bigguns Big Chill- C Dygos(Owner- Murray Murphy)
2nd-FTCH AFC Forger-C Dygos (Owner R & P Magnusson)
3rd-AFTCH Mjolnir Bluebill of Allanport- S. Adams
4th-Pilkingtons Power Struggle- C Swanson (Owner-J. Richardson)
RCM- AFTCH 5th Avenue's Mighty Maximus- Bruce Macdonald (Alberta!)
CM- FTCH Sandy's Tribute to Rock & Roll -Vic Ricci
Junior - 13 starters
1st - Springwater Quick to the Maxx - M Ormdby
2nd - Springwater Dee- Vic Ricci
3rd - Mjolnir's that'll be the Day- Shirly greener
4th - Springwaters Nubile Lady- Irene Batson
RCM- Kapriver Emmy Lou- Vic Ricci
cm- Bluenorth's Rainbow Wizard- Dieter Maier
cm- Mjolnirs Dana of Longpoint-Vera Ahern
cm - The Springwaters Redneck Raven -Albert Coles
cm - Oakridgetvr going all the way- Lorraine Hare
